Here are some questions you need to answer to determine which Quickbooks (QB) program is right for you:
- Do you want access anywhere at anytime? (if yes, use Quickbooks online)
- Do you want to allow employees to access your file?
- How many users will be on your QB file?
- Do you need to track inventory?
- Do you manufacture products? (If you need to keep track of assemblies, use the Quickbooks Premiere Manufacturers edition)
- Do you want to use the payroll function? (Quickbooks Simple Start and Quickbooks Online don’t have payroll functionality)
- Do you want industry specific reports? Example: retail or construction

| Program | Cost | When to use |
| Quickbooks Simple Start | FREE or $99.99 for more functionality | No employees or inventory and very limited reporting capabilities |
| Quickbooks Online | $9.95/month and up | Gives access online, anywhere |
| Quickbooks Pro, or Pro for Mac | Average $150-$200 | All of my clients use this version and this is the one I recommend most of the time |
| Quickbooks Premiere | Average $350-400 | If you want industry specific tools and reports |
| Quickbooks Enterprise Solutions | $3,000 and up | For larger manufacturing operations (can use sales orders, backorder tracking, etc.) |
